docker run -v 挂载数据卷异常
程序员文章站
2022-05-14 20:50:04
...
用docker启动redis的时候出现以下异常:
[root@centos7 redis]# docker run -d -p 6379:6379 -v $PWD/data:/data redis --appendonly yes
d06e8905aeb84458e5930e086f0a087d2ef35774c0cc6a3e1ff9f74b5925a80b
[root@centos7 redis]# docker logs d0
chown: changing ownership of './appendonly.aof': Permission denied
chown: changing ownership of '.': Permission denied
解决方案,加上–privileged=true
docker run -d -p 6379:6379 -v $PWD/data:/data --privileged=true redis --appendonly yes
注:–privileged=true最好紧跟 -v指令,要不然可能不起作用。
上一篇: 这是主人让我们脱掉衣服,甩开膀子吃……
下一篇: AngularJS路由切换实现方法分析
推荐阅读
-
浅谈Docker 容器数据卷挂载小结
-
docker容器数据卷之具名挂载和匿名挂载问题
-
docker挂载本地目录和数据卷容器操作
-
Docker卷(volume)的使用,挂载宿主机目录到容器目录,实现docker数据存储分离
-
使用 docker-compose 挂载数据卷创建 SVN 服务器
-
解决 Docker 数据卷挂载的文件权限问题
-
docker run -v 挂载数据卷异常
-
docker run -v 挂载数据卷
-
docker 的数据卷挂载volume(持久化)及其意义(三种方式--volume,自定义volume,volume继承)
-
Docker中未指定挂载点容器间volume卷的数据共享